Description
The PXI Embedded Controller with the part number 186595F-630 is a robust unit designed for versatile applications. This controller, known as the PXI-8170, is powered by an Intel Processor and comes with a pre-installed operating system. Users have the choice between Microsoft Windows 98 or NT, with an option to upgrade to Windows 2000, providing flexibility depending on the user’s requirements.
It conforms to the 3U Eurocard size standard, ensuring compatibility with a range of chassis types. The system boasts 64 MB of 100 MHz SDRAM, which can be upgraded to a maximum of 256 MB to accommodate more demanding applications. Storage is handled by 1 ultra DMA33 hard drive, ensuring quick data access and storage.
For connectivity, it is equipped with 1 serial port, 1 parallel port, and 1 USB port, allowing for the connection of various peripherals. The integrated Super VGA with 2 MB DRAM provides crisp and clear display capabilities. Expansion is made possible through 1 system slot and 3 controller expansion slots, offering ample room for additional hardware.
The controller measures 8.1 x 13 x 21.6 cm and weighs 1.1 Kg (2.4 lb), making it a compact yet powerful solution. It is compatible with the PXI-1020 and PXI-1025 chassis, ensuring that it can be integrated into existing setups with ease. The peripheral expansion features include a PCI local bus and AGP (266 Mbytes/s), providing high-speed data transfer capabilities. The PCI Bus Throughput maxes out at 132 Mbytes, ensuring that the controller can handle a substantial amount of data.
